Fortressing Your Digital Life: A Guide to Information Security in Today's World

In the digital age, our lives are inextricably linked to the internet. From banking to social media, our most precious data resides in the ether, vulnerable to an ever-evolving landscape of threats. But fear not, intrepid digital citizen! This post is your guide to building an impenetrable fortress around your information security, ensuring your digital life remains worry-free.

The Invisible Enemy:
First, let's recognize the adversaries. Hackers, malware, and data breaches are no longer the stuff of Hollywood thrillers. They're cunning, adaptable, and constantly evolving, lurking in the shadows of every click and download. From phishing scams disguised as friendly emails to sophisticated ransomware attacks, these threats can wreak havoc on your finances, privacy, and even your reputation.

Building Your Digital Fort in 2024:

So, how do we defend ourselves? It's not about paranoia, but about proactive vigilance. Here are some essential tools in your information security arsenal:

The Password Paladin: Strong, unique passwords are your first line of defense. Ditch the dictionary entries and embrace complexity! Mix uppercase and lowercase letters, numbers, and special characters. And remember, never reuse the same password across multiple accounts.

The Two-Factor Fortress: Think of this as a moat around your castle. Two-factor authentication adds an extra layer of security by requiring a second verification step, like a code sent to your phone, before granting access.
The Firewall Guardian: This trusty sentinel monitors incoming and outgoing traffic, blocking suspicious activity before it can infiltrate your system. Keep it updated and consider investing in a reputable antivirus program for additional protection.

The Encryption Enchanter: This magic cloak scrambles your data, making it unreadable to unauthorized eyes. Encrypt sensitive files and emails to ensure only the intended recipient can access them.
The Vigilant Update: Software updates often contain crucial security patches, so make sure to install them promptly. Don't let outdated software become a vulnerability for hackers to exploit.

Beyond the Walls:
Remember, information security is not just about technical tools. It's also about awareness and vigilance:
Be wary of suspicious links and attachments, even from seemingly trusted sources.

Think before you click! Social media quizzes and surveys might seem harmless, but they could be fishing for your personal information.
Beware of public Wi-Fi networks. If you must use them, avoid accessing sensitive information like bank accounts or online payments.

Stay informed about current cyber threats and scams. Keep yourself updated by reading reputable news sources and security blogs.
By taking these proactive steps, you'll transform your digital life from a vulnerable hamlet to a secure fortress. Remember, information security is an ongoing journey, not a one-time fix. Stay vigilant, adapt to evolving threats, and enjoy the peace of mind that comes from knowing your digital life is well-protected.

So, the next time you venture online, remember: you are not alone. With a little awareness and these essential tools, you can navigate the digital landscape with confidence, knowing your information is safe and secure. Now go forth, brave explorer, and conquer the digital world!

Elevate Your Digital Safety: The Art of Security Awareness

Introduction:
In today's interconnected world, security awareness is the cornerstone of safeguarding our digital lives. The internet has redefined our way of life and work, but it has also introduced a slew of evolving threats to our personal and professional information. To fortify your defenses against these threats, it's imperative to remain well-informed and perpetually vigilant. In this article, we will delve into essential security awareness practices that will enable you to navigate the digital realm with confidence.

Craft Robust Passwords:
Your initial line of defense starts with crafting robust passwords. Utilize a blend of upper and lower case letters, numbers, and special characters. Shun easily guessable information such as your name or birthdate. Consider employing passphrases – longer and inherently more secure. Regularly update your passwords and make use of a reliable password manager to streamline your credentials.

Implement Multi-Factor Authentication (MFA):
MFA augments your security by mandating two or more forms of identity verification before granting access to an account. This significantly reduces the likelihood of unauthorized entry, even if your password is compromised.

Stay Alert to Phishing Attacks:
Phishing is a common ploy utilized by cybercriminals to deceive individuals into disclosing sensitive information. Exercise prudence when confronted with unsolicited emails, messages, or phone calls requesting personal or financial details. Always verify the legitimacy of the sender before responding or clicking on embedded links.

Maintain Software and System Updates:
Obsolete software and operating systems are susceptible to exploitation. Routinely update your devices and applications to patch known security vulnerabilities. Activate automatic updates whenever possible to ensure protection against emerging threats.

Secure Your Wi-Fi Network:
For home Wi-Fi networks, ensure their safeguarding with a robust password. Discard default router passwords, employ WPA3 encryption if available, and shield your network's name (SSID) from public view. Regularly review and modify your Wi-Fi password to maintain security.

Knowledge is Power: Educate Yourself and Others:
Stay abreast of the latest cybersecurity threats and best practices. Share this knowledge with your family, friends, and colleagues to establish a network of vigilant individuals. Cybersecurity is a collective responsibility.

Backup Your Data:
Consistently back up crucial data to an external drive or secure cloud storage. This practice guarantees the ability to restore files in the event of ransomware attacks, hardware failures, or data loss.

Guard Your Devices:
Utilize robust passcodes or employ biometric authentication methods, such as fingerprint or facial recognition, to protect your mobile devices and computers. These measures prevent unauthorized access in the event of theft or loss.

Privacy Settings Are Paramount:
Scrutinize privacy settings on your social media accounts, apps, and online services. Curtail the information you make publicly available and only connect with individuals you trust.

Report Suspected Activity:
If you encounter any unusual or malicious online activity, report it to the relevant authorities or the pertinent service provider. Swift reporting can mitigate further damage.

Conclusion:
Security awareness stands as a pivotal aspect of our digital existence. By adopting the above practices and maintaining vigilance, you can safeguard your personal and professional data from the ever-present cyber threats. Remember, proactive defense is your best shield. Remain secure, stay informed, and navigate the digital realm with confidence!
